List of ETFs with Amazon.com Inc. and Amgen Inc. Exposure

When looking for ETFs that provide exposure to Amazon.com Inc. and Amgen Inc. within the Nasdaq, you have several options to consider. These ETFs offer a convenient way to invest in these companies without the need to buy individual stocks. Here is a list of some notable ETFs: Invesco QQQ Trust (QQQ): While not exclusive to Amazon and Amgen, QQQ tracks the Nasdaq-100 Index, which includes these two companies, among others. It offers broad exposure to technology and growth companies. First Trust NASDAQ-100 Technology Sector Index Fund (QTEC): QTEC focuses on technology-related companies within the Nasdaq-100 Index, including Amazon and Amgen. Direxion NASDAQ-100 Equal Weighted Index Shares (QQQE): QQE provides equal-weighted exposure to the Nasdaq-100 Index, meaning Amazon and Amgen have the same weight as other companies in the index. iShares NASDAQ Biotechnology ETF (IBB): IBB offers exposure to the biotechnology sector within the Nasdaq Composite Index, which includes Amgen.

ETFs with Amazon.com Inc. and Amgen Inc.: Comparisons

Now, let's compare these ETFs to understand their differences and similarities: QQQ vs. QTEC vs. QQQE: QQQ offers broad exposure to the entire Nasdaq-100 Index, including Amazon and Amgen, while QTEC concentrates on technology-related companies. QQE, on the other hand, equally weights all companies in the index. IBB vs. QQQ: IBB focuses exclusively on biotechnology companies within the Nasdaq Composite Index, making it a more targeted choice for those specifically interested in Amgen and similar firms. QQQ, as mentioned earlier, provides broader market exposure.

Amazon.com Inc. and Amgen Inc.: Benefits of Investing in These ETFs

Investing in ETFs that include Amazon.com Inc. and Amgen Inc. offers several advantages: Diversification: These ETFs provide exposure to a basket of stocks, reducing the risk associated with investing in individual companies. Liquidity: ETFs like QQQ and IBB are highly liquid, making it easy to buy and sell shares at market prices. Cost Efficiency: ETFs typically have lower expense ratios compared to actively managed funds, which can result in cost savings over time. Convenience: ETFs are traded on exchanges, allowing you to buy and sell shares throughout the trading day. Dividend Payments: Some ETFs, like QQQ, may distribute dividends, providing income to investors.

Amazon.com Inc. and Amgen Inc.: Considerations Before Investing

Before investing in these ETFs, it's essential to consider the following: Risk Tolerance: Understand your risk tolerance and investment goals. ETFs can be subject to market volatility. Expense Ratios: Compare the expense ratios of different ETFs to ensure you're getting value for your investment. Diversification: Evaluate whether the ETF's holdings align with your desired level of diversification. Tax Implications: Be aware of potential tax consequences, such as capital gains, when buying and selling ETF shares. Long-Term vs. Short-Term: Determine your investment horizon; ETFs can be suitable for both short-term trading and long-term investing.
